According to a report from Deadline, Amazon MGM Studios has announced that it is reviewing the critically-acclaimed ‘Fallout’ series for a third season well ahead of its Season 2 premiere date.

Season 2 is set to premiere in December 2025.

Adapted from the video game franchise of the same name, ‘Fallout’ is a critically-acclaimed series filled with excellent performances from Ella Purnell, Walton Goggins, and Aaron Moten.

“We are absolutely thrilled that our global Prime Video customers will be able to delve deeper into the wonderfully surreal and captivating world of ‘Fallout,'” Amazon MGM Studios global head of television Vernon Sanders said.

“Jonah [Nolan], Lisa [Joy], Geneva [Robertson-Dworet], and Graham [Wagner] have done an exceptional job bringing this beloved video game franchise to vivid life on Prime Video.

“Together with our amazing partners at Bethesda Games and Bethesda Softworks, we are delighted to announce a third season of Fallout, well ahead of the much-anticipated debut of Season Two.”

“The holidays came a little early this year – we are thrilled to be ending the world all over again for a third season of Fallout,” executive producers Jonathan Nolan and Lisa Joy said.

“On behalf of our brilliant cast and crew, our showrunners Geneva and Graham, and our partners at Bethesda, we’re grateful to our incredible collaborators at Amazon MGM Studios and to the amazing fans as we continue our adventures in the wasteland together.”

“We’re so grateful to have survived the apocalypse for another season! Thanks to the incredible team — our whole cast and crew, Kilter, and Amazon,” showrunners Geneva Robertson-Dworet and Graham Wagner said.

According to its official synopsis, ‘Fallout’ is “the story of haves and have-nots in a world in which there’s almost nothing left to have. Two-hundred years after the apocalypse, the gentle denizens of luxury fallout shelters are forced to return to the irradiated hellscape their ancestors left behind—and are shocked to discover an incredibly complex, gleefully weird, and highly violent universe waiting for them.”

The first season was beloved by new viewers and longtime fans of the video game series alike. It earned countless award nominations, including Outstanding Drama Series at the Primetime Emmy Awards.
